The men's shot put at the 2022 World Athletics U20 Championships was held at Estadio Olímpico Pascual Guerrero on 1 and 2 August.[1]

Records

[edit]
Standing records prior to the 2022 World Athletics U20 Championships
World U20 Record  Jacko Gill (NZL) 23.00 Auckland, New Zealand 18 August 2013
Championship Record  Jacko Gill (NZL) 22.20 Barcelona, Spain 11 July 2012
World U20 Leading  Tizian Lauria (GER) 21.15 Riederich, Germany 15 June 2022

Final

[edit]

The final was held on 2 August at 17:16.[4]

Rank Name Nationality Round Mark Notes
1 2 3 4 5 6
1st place, gold medalist(s) Tarik Robinson-O'Hagan  Vereinigte Staaten 20.30 20.03 x 20.73 20.08 20.20 20.73 PB
2nd place, silver medalist(s) Kobe Lawrence  Jamaika x 20.36 19.42 19.87 20.58 18.80 20.58 PB
3rd place, bronze medalist(s) Tizian Lauria  Deutschland x 19.34 19.94 20.40 19.97 20.55 20.55
4 Lukas Schober  Deutschland 18.84 19.21 19.43 19.27 x 19.08 19.43
5 Karel Šula  Slowakei 18.46 18.66 18.73 18.88 18.60 x 18.88
6 Mátyás Kerékgyártó  Ungarn 18.31 18.42 18.82 18.31 18.32 18.68 18.82
7 Jesper Ahlin  Schweden 18.36 18.18 18.50 x 18.62 18.40 18.62
8 Juan Manuel Arrieguez  Argentinien 17.91 18.54 x 18.14 18.28 18.17 18.54
9 Leo Zikovic  Schweden 18.22 18.37 x 18.37
10 Jakub Korejba  Polen x 17.64 18.31 18.31
11 Andreas De Lathauwer  Belgien 17.29 17.60 17.69 17.69
